FORT Robotics, a pioneer in robot and mobile machine safety systems, has unveiled the Wireless E-Stop Pro, a safety-certified wearable built to reduce incidents and improve operational uptime at advanced worksites around the globe.
As mobile and autonomous machines become more common across industrial environments, traditional safety measures—such as fixed emergency stop buttons—are no longer sufficient. The Wireless E-Stop Pro places reliable, fail-safe control directly with the operator, enabling a certified emergency stop to be issued from distances of up to 200 meters. This ensures safety measures can keep pace with the dynamic nature of modern job sites.
“Safety should enable productivity, not slow it down,” said Amod Damle, Head of Product at FORT, who brings extensive experience from Fetch Robotics and Cisco. “The Wireless E-Stop Pro removes the trade-off between safety and efficiency. Whether worn on the body or customized for specialized environments, it delivers confidence and flexibility. We’re reshaping how people interact with machines—empowering operators to work faster, smarter, and with complete control.”
Advanced Safety Built for Demanding Environments
The Wireless E-Stop Pro builds on FORT’s proven safety platform, addressing the challenges of today’s globally distributed and radio-dense industrial settings:

- Optimized for High-Interference Areas: Powered by advanced long-range Bluetooth technology, the device maintains a stable connection in facilities filled with competing wireless signals, allowing multiple systems to operate concurrently with minimal disruption.
- Ready for Worldwide Use: Global Bluetooth compatibility enables OEMs to deploy machines across regions with ease. The device holds regulatory approvals for operation in the United States, Canada, Europe, Japan, and Australia.
- High Safety Assurance: Independently certified to Safety Integrity Level (SIL) 3 under IEC 61508 standards, the Pro model delivers validated reliability for critical applications.
- Dependable in Tough Conditions: With a wireless range of up to 200 meters and a durable IP65-rated housing, the device performs consistently in harsh environments. A built-in status display offers clear, immediate visibility into connectivity and system status.
The Wireless E-Stop Pro expands the FORT Pro Series, a suite of control solutions designed to support the safe rollout of intelligent machines. It works seamlessly with FORT’s Endpoint Controller receiver and can be paired with the Safe Remote Control Pro and the FORT Manager cloud platform for streamlined device management and configuration.
